How did King Midas get rid of the golden touch?

The god Dionysus was pleased Midas had helped his friend and offered to grant Midas a wish. King Midas wished that everything he touched would turn to gold. Dionysus told Midas how he could get rid of the gift. Midas washed his ‘golden touch’ away in the river Pactolus.

Did Midas have a wife?

The King Midas who ruled Phrygia in the late 8th century BC is known from Greek and Assyrian sources. According to the former, he married a Greek princess, Damodice, daughter of Agamemnon of Cyme, and traded extensively with the Greeks.

Where is King Midas buried?

It all started with a tomb, the Midas Tumulus, in central Turkey at the ancient site of Gordion, which was excavated by the Penn Museum in 1957, over 50 years ago.

Did King Midas have a son?

Midas had a son named Lityerses and a daughter named Zoe. Later he helped judge a music competition between Pan’s pipes and Apollo’s lyre. He was the only one who voted Pan and Apollo cursed Midas with the ears of a donkey. His barber was the only mortal who knew and he swore not to tell.

Who was King Midas ‘ family?

In one, Midas was king of Pessinus, a city of Phrygia , who as a child was adopted by King Gordias and Cybele, the goddess whose consort he was, and who (by some accounts) was the goddess-mother of Midas himself.
